創(chuàng)建和調(diào)試Android Things程序
大家好!今天我給大家介紹一下“通過Android Studio創(chuàng)建并調(diào)試Android Things程序的方法”。初次在Android Studio中創(chuàng)建Android Things程序時,可能會出現(xiàn)
大家好!今天我給大家介紹一下“通過Android Studio創(chuàng)建并調(diào)試Android Things程序的方法”。初次在Android Studio中創(chuàng)建Android Things程序時,可能會出現(xiàn)各種組件安裝提示,根據(jù)提示安裝缺失的組件即可保證成功編譯和運行Android Things程序。如果您覺得這篇教程有幫助,請為我投上寶貴的一票(順便求個關(guān)注),謝謝!
創(chuàng)建新項目
1. 啟動Android Studio,在出現(xiàn)的“Android Studio歡迎界面”中,點擊“Start a New Android Studio project”按鈕,開始創(chuàng)建一個新的Android Studio項目。
2. 在“創(chuàng)建新項目界面”中,將應(yīng)用程序名稱設(shè)置為“AndroidThingsDemo1”,根據(jù)需要設(shè)置公司域名,選中“Include C support”后,點擊“Next按鈕”進(jìn)入下一步。
3. 在“目標(biāo)Android設(shè)備界面”中,僅選中“Android Things”并根據(jù)樹莓派3B上安裝Android Things系統(tǒng)的版本選擇API級別。設(shè)置完畢后,點擊“Next按鈕”進(jìn)入下一步。
4. 在“添加Activity到Things界面”界面中,選擇“Android Things Empty Activity”,然后點擊“Next按鈕”進(jìn)入下一步。
5. 在“配置Activity界面”中,點擊“Next按鈕”進(jìn)入下一步。
6. 在“定制C 支持界面”中,可以選擇C 標(biāo)準(zhǔn)的版本以及是否支持C 異常和運行時類型識別。設(shè)置完畢后,點擊“Finish按鈕”完成項目創(chuàng)建。
配置環(huán)境
7. 耐心等待一段時間(可能會比較長),直到Android Studio配置編譯完新項目并出現(xiàn)開發(fā)主界面。在出現(xiàn)開發(fā)界面后,可能會給出各種Android組件安裝提示,根據(jù)提示安裝即可。另外,為了編譯C 項目,需要在“Android SDK管理器”中安裝CMake工具。
8. 將Android SDK中包含“adb.exe”程序的目錄添加到系統(tǒng)PATH變量中。然后啟動命令行程序,輸入命令“adb connect <樹莓派3B系統(tǒng)IP>”并回車。如果連接到Android Things系統(tǒng)成功,則會在控制臺中見到連接成功的提示信息。
調(diào)試運行
9. 調(diào)試運行新創(chuàng)建的Android Things項目,在彈出的“部署目標(biāo)窗口”中,選擇“Google Iot_rpi3”(通過adb連接上的Android Things系統(tǒng))并確定。
10. 再次耐心等待,直到樹莓派3B屏幕上出現(xiàn)調(diào)試的APP界面。
11. 項目調(diào)試運行成功后,可以通過Android Studio的Logcat面板查看各種提示信息。點擊工具欄上的“停止按鈕”即可停止調(diào)試。當(dāng)Android Things App在樹莓派3B上安裝成功后,每次重啟Android Things系統(tǒng)時,總會自動打開上一次安裝的APP。